# Checkout Load Testing — Who to Contact

Load tests against the Pardle checkout flow run through the Torsk harness, staging only. Never point it at prod; the payment stub lives in staging by design.

Ownership: the Flowline team owns the harness, the Checkout Guild owns pass/fail thresholds. Capacity bumps need sign-off from infra at least two days ahead.

If a run stalls past 30 minutes, kill it via the Torsk console and file a ticket. For scheduling slots or threshold questions, email the Flowline rotation directly.

billing contact of tahaf-kafop = istwyn_fraox@norvaworks.corp

**Ticket VQ-218: Validator plugin pool exhausts connections on reload**

When the Quillmark validator plugin registry hot-reloads, each plugin re-opens its own pool without closing the prior one. After three reloads, the staging database rejects new sessions. Please review the teardown hook in `plugin_host.py` carefully. To reproduce, point the host at the staging instance using the connection string below.

database URL for tajog-bajeg: mysql://soreth_svc:OzsCjhu@db-6997.nelvrostack.internal:5432/kelax

Ticket: Staging env misconfigured for Siftgate bloom filter

The bloom layer in front of the Pellet KV store is rejecting all lookups in staging because the env file was copied from the dev template without credentials. False-positive tuning values are fine; only the auth line is missing. To unblock the weekly demo, the Pellet admission secret must be set on the following line.

env line for yaguf-fajop: LEDGER_TOKEN13=fb08984397349

Ticket: Incremental rebuild hooks for Lattice Press plugins

Plugin authors targeting Lattice Press 4.x should note that incremental static rebuilds now invalidate only pages whose content hashes changed. If your plugin writes derived assets, you must register them via the new dependency manifest, or they will be silently skipped during partial rebuilds. Please review the attached spec carefully before the freeze. This change requires sign-off from the build pipeline owner.

account owner for bawip-tahag: Raleth Quenok